☐ Contract shuttle, Halverton office to Brim Street annex. Grab the grey folio of signed Quillmark agreements from the records cabinet, double-check the tamper strip, and log the count on the run sheet before you head out. Nothing fancy, just don't leave it unattended in the van. When the courier arrives, pass along this confidential hand-over instruction exactly as written.

handover note for yagef-bagep: the drudor pelius courier leaves the kasdor zorvan norir ledger at gate 8016 under passcode 755406

## Sensor drift: what to do at 3am

If the GrowLoop controller starts reporting humidity swings that don't match the backup probes in the Fernwick greenhouse, it's almost always sensor drift, not an actual climate event. Don't panic and don't touch the vents manually. First, restart the calibration daemon and give it ten minutes to re-baseline. If readings still disagree by more than 5%, flip the controller into safe mode. The safe-mode thresholds it will use are these.

config for yahap-bajof:
[istix]
host = istix.qorvelsys.internal
user = istix_svc
database = istix_prod

Capacity note: metrics sidecar (Pipwhistle)

Quick heads-up for whoever inherits this. Pipwhistle buffers metrics in memory before flushing to the aggregator, so its footprint scales with flush interval times series cardinality. On the Brundle cluster we saw ~180MB per pod at peak, which is fine, but if tenants add labels carelessly it balloons fast. Keep the buffer cap conservative and let backpressure do its job. Current values we've settled on after two rounds of load testing are:

tuning table, kajog-bawip:
TIERS = {
    "kelius": 256,
    "lammir": 543,
}